1. Summer watering methodThe weather is relatively dry in summer, and water evaporates faster than usual, so you need to water more often. In summer, you can do it once every 1-2 days, but in bad weather or rainy days, you should reduce the frequency and control the amount of watering. Don't water the money tree too much. If the soil has poor drainage, water will accumulate. If the roots are in water for a long time, they will rot. In summer, you can also spray water on the leaves more often to increase the humidity of the growing environment. When you want to water, you can look at the color of the soil in the pot. If it is white or cracked, you should water it in time. You can also decide based on the sound of knocking on the soil in the pot. When it sounds hollow, you should water it. 2. Summer maintenance methods1. Light: Do not expose it to strong sunlight at noon for a long time. Move it in time or use artificial shading methods. 2. Temperature: It should be given a growing environment of 15-30℃. The temperature in summer is relatively high, so you can move it indoors or use water spraying to lower the temperature. 3. Fertilization: In summer, it is best to apply fully decomposed liquid fertilizer, or you can use mixed flower fertilizer. The frequency of fertilization is generally once every half a month. |
